Who doesn’t love to receive surprise gifts, especially when the bearer of those gifts is none other than Beyoncé?

On September 19, Cardi B took to Twitter to share that she had received an unexpected present from Queen B. The gift was a vinyl of Beyoncé’s latest no. 1 album Renaissance. It also came with a handwritten note from the “Alien Superstar” singer: “Hard working, beautiful, and talented queen. Thank you for always supporting me. Sending so much love to you and yours.”

“Look what Beyoncé sent me. Read it, b*tch,” Cardi B laughed while holding up the vinyl in a video. “It was so beautiful, so lovely. I’m gonna put it in a glass frame with some laser beams on it. Anyone who gets mothaf*ckin’ next to it is gonna get electrocuted on mothaf*ckin’ site.” We’re sure Cardi is joking, but Beyoncé presents do need to be protected at all costs.

“I just wanna say ‘thank you so much.’ I feel so special,” Cardi went on to say before breaking into a rendition of “Plastic Off the Sofa,” which is track eight on Renaissance.

This isn’t the first time that Bey has shown love to Cardi B, a devoted member of her Beehive. The “WAP” rapper made a cameo in Beyonce’s Homecoming documentary on Netflix and was featured in her first TikTok that showed fans celebrating the release of “Break My Soul.” Cardi has also been actively participating in the #PlasticOfTheSofaChallenge. Safe to say it’s one of Cardi’s favorite songs on the album.

Beyoncé has clearly been in the giving mood this Virgo season. Not only did she throw a star-studded birthday party that included guests such as Zendaya, Lizzo, and Halle Bailey, but she’s also been giving vinyl records to Megan The Stallion and a large flower arrangement to Sheryl Lee Ralph to congratulate her on her monumental Emmy win. (Beyoncé reprised Ralph’s role of Deena in Dream Girls.)
